MTEX

MTEX is an open-source MATLAB package specifically designed for the analysis of electron backscatter diffraction (EBSD) data, which are widely used to analyse the crystallographic orientation of materials at the microscale. == History == The development of MTEX began in 2008, spearheaded by Ralf Hielscher, who aimed to create a user-friendly platform that could facilitate the analysis of large datasets generated by EBSD. The toolbox has since evolved, incorporating various features that allow for the manipulation and visualisation of crystallographic data.
